Output e2defcbe89c7f3d776b42aec383a521f62b95d23852aa68b9e5abed1995c92e5:2

value
704195
script pubkey
OP_0 OP_PUSHBYTES_20 4e8ae61eff7e350893c7a1255d8c54c52b139bba
address
bc1qf69wv8hl0c6s3y785yj4mrz5c5438xa6l7hpva
transaction
e2defcbe89c7f3d776b42aec383a521f62b95d23852aa68b9e5abed1995c92e5
spent
true